-
公开(公告)号:US20180345958A1
公开(公告)日:2018-12-06
申请号:US15611397
申请日:2017-06-01
Applicant: Waymo LLC
Inventor: Wan-Yen Lo , Abhijit Ogale , David Ferguson
Abstract: In some implementations, an autonomous or semi-autonomous vehicle is capable of using a collision prediction system to determine a confidence that any objects detected within a vicinity of the vehicle are on a trajectory that will collide with the vehicle. Laser obstacle points derived from recent sensor readings of one or more sensors of a vehicle are initially obtained. The laser obstacle points are projected into a pose coordinate system to generate an occupancy grid of a vicinity of the vehicle. A confidence that any objects represented by the laser obstacle points are on a trajectory that will collide with the vehicle is determined by applying a particle filter to the occupancy grid.
-
公开(公告)号:US09727795B1
公开(公告)日:2017-08-08
申请号:US15018077
申请日:2016-02-08
Applicant: Waymo LLC
Inventor: Wan-Yen Lo , David Ian Franklin Ferguson , Abhijit Ogale
CPC classification number: G06K9/00798 , B60R1/00 , G06K9/00791 , G06K9/00805 , G06K9/00845 , G06K9/4647 , G06K9/4652 , G06K9/52 , G06K9/6215 , G06K2009/4666 , G06T7/20 , G06T7/408 , G06T2207/30256
Abstract: Methods and systems for real-time road flare detection using templates and appropriate color spaces are described. A computing device of a vehicle may be configured to receive an image of an environment of the vehicle. The computing device may be configured to identify a given pixels in the plurality of pixels having one or more of: (i) a red color value greater than a green color value, and (ii) the red color value greater than a blue color value. Further, the computing device may be configured to make a comparison between one or more characteristics of a shape of an object represented by the given pixels in the image and corresponding one or more characteristics of a predetermined shape of a road flare; and determine a likelihood that the object represents the road flare.
-
公开(公告)号:US12174640B2
公开(公告)日:2024-12-24
申请号:US18484090
申请日:2023-10-10
Applicant: Waymo LLC
Inventor: David Ian Ferguson , Wan-Yen Lo , Nathaniel Fairfield
Abstract: Disclosed herein are systems and methods for providing supplemental identification abilities to an autonomous vehicle system. The sensor unit of the vehicle may be configured to receive data indicating an environment of the vehicle, while the control system may be configured to operate the vehicle. The vehicle may also include a processing unit configured to analyze the data indicating the environment to determine at least one object having a detection confidence below a threshold. Based on the at least one object having a detection confidence below a threshold, the processor may communicate at least a subset of the data indicating the environment for further processing. The vehicle is also configured to receive an indication of an object confirmation of the subset of the data. Based on the object confirmation of the subset of the data, the processor may alter the control of the vehicle by the control system.
-
公开(公告)号:US11783180B1
公开(公告)日:2023-10-10
申请号:US16983957
申请日:2020-08-03
Applicant: Waymo LLC
Inventor: Abhijit Ogale , Alexander Krizhevsky , Wan-Yen Lo
CPC classification number: G06N3/08 , G05D1/0088 , G06N3/04 , G06N7/01
Abstract: Methods, systems, and apparatus, including computer programs encoded on computer storage media, for generating object predictions using a neural network. One of the methods includes receiving respective projections of a plurality of channels of input sensor data, wherein each channel of input sensor data represents different respective characteristics of electromagnetic radiation reflected off of one or more objects. Each of the projections of the plurality of channels of input sensor data are provided to a neural network subsystem trained to receive projections of input sensor data as input and to provide an object prediction as an output. At the output of the neural network subsystem, an object prediction that predicts a region of space that is likely to be occupied by an object is received.
-
公开(公告)号:US11531894B1
公开(公告)日:2022-12-20
申请号:US17013117
申请日:2020-09-04
Applicant: Waymo LLC
Inventor: Abhijit Ogale , Alexander Krizhevsky , Wan-Yen Lo
Abstract: A neural network system for identifying positions of objects in an input image can include an object detector neural network, a memory interface subsystem, and an external memory. The object detector neural network is configured to, at each time step of multiple successive time steps, (i) receive a first neural network input that represents the input image and a second neural network input that identifies a first set of positions of the input image that have each been classified as showing a respective object of the set of objects, and (ii) process the first and second inputs to generate a set of output scores that each represents a respective likelihood that an object that is not one of the objects shown at any of the positions in the first set of positions is shown at a respective position of the input image that corresponds to the output score.
-
公开(公告)号:US11281918B1
公开(公告)日:2022-03-22
申请号:US17076416
申请日:2020-10-21
Applicant: Waymo LLC
Inventor: Wan-Yen Lo , David I. Ferguson
IPC: G06K9/00 , G06T15/20 , B60W30/00 , G01C21/00 , G05D1/02 , G06T7/50 , G06T7/70 , B60R1/00 , B60R11/04 , G05D1/00 , G06K9/62 , G06T17/10
Abstract: Disclosed herein are methods and systems for determining a location of an object within an environment. An example method may include determining a three-dimensional (3D) location of a plurality of reference points in an environment, receiving a two-dimensional (2D) image of a portion of the environment that contains an object, selecting certain reference points from the plurality of reference points that form a polygon when projected into the 2D image that contains at least a portion of the object, determining an intersection point of a ray directed toward the object and a 3D polygon formed by the selected reference points, and based on the intersection point of the ray directed toward the object and the 3D polygon formed by the selected reference points, determining a 3D location of the object in the environment.
-
公开(公告)号:US10853668B1
公开(公告)日:2020-12-01
申请号:US16227074
申请日:2018-12-20
Applicant: Waymo LLC
Inventor: Wan-Yen Lo , David I. Ferguson
IPC: G06K9/00 , G06K9/62 , B60R11/04 , B60W30/00 , G06T17/10 , G06T15/20 , G06T7/70 , G06T7/50 , G05D1/02 , G05D1/00 , G01C21/00 , B60R1/00
Abstract: Disclosed herein are methods and systems for determining a location of an object within an environment. An example method may include determining a three-dimensional (3D) location of a plurality of reference points in an environment, receiving a two-dimensional (2D) image of a portion of the environment that contains an object, selecting certain reference points from the plurality of reference points that form a polygon when projected into the 2D image that contains at least a portion of the object, determining an intersection point of a ray directed toward the object and a 3D polygon formed by the selected reference points, and based on the intersection point of the ray directed toward the object and the 3D polygon formed by the selected reference points, determining a 3D location of the object in the environment.
-
公开(公告)号:US10769809B1
公开(公告)日:2020-09-08
申请号:US16022901
申请日:2018-06-29
Applicant: Waymo LLC
Inventor: Abhijit Ogale , Alexander Krizhevsky , Wan-Yen Lo
Abstract: A neural network system for identifying positions of objects in an input image can include an object detector neural network, a memory interface subsystem, and an external memory. The object detector neural network is configured to, at each time step of multiple successive time steps, (i) receive a first neural network input that represents the input image and a second neural network input that identifies a first set of positions of the input image that have each been classified as showing a respective object of the set of objects, and (ii) process the first and second inputs to generate a set of output scores that each represents a respective likelihood that an object that is not one of the objects shown at any of the positions in the first set of positions is shown at a respective position of the input image that corresponds to the output score.
-
公开(公告)号:US10733506B1
公开(公告)日:2020-08-04
申请号:US15378845
申请日:2016-12-14
Applicant: Waymo LLC
Inventor: Abhijit Ogale , Alexander Krizhevsky , Wan-Yen Lo
Abstract: Methods, systems, and apparatus, including computer programs encoded on computer storage media, for generating object predictions using a neural network. One of the methods includes receiving respective projections of a plurality of channels of input sensor data, wherein each channel of input sensor data represents different respective characteristics of electromagnetic radiation reflected off of one or more objects. Each of the projections of the plurality of channels of input sensor data are provided to a neural network subsystem trained to receive projections of input sensor data as input and to provide an object prediction as an output. At the output of the neural network subsystem, an object prediction that predicts a region of space that is likely to be occupied by an object is received.
-
公开(公告)号:US10678258B2
公开(公告)日:2020-06-09
申请号:US16191835
申请日:2018-11-15
Applicant: Waymo LLC
Inventor: Wan-Yen Lo , David Ian Franklin Ferguson , Abhijit Ogale
Abstract: A computing device of a first vehicle may receive a first image and a second image of a second vehicle having flashing light signals. The computing device may determine, in the first image and the second image, an image region that bounds the second vehicle such that the image region substantially encompasses the second vehicle. The computing device may determine a polar grid that partitions the image region in the first image and the second image into polar bins, and identify portions of image data exhibiting a change in color and a change in brightness between the first image and the second image. The computing device may determine a type of the flashing light signals and a type of the second vehicle; and accordingly provide instructions to control the first vehicle.
-
-
-
-
-
-
-
-
-